The Autobiography of Mark Twain
July 12th, 2010 · Comments Off
Here’s a PBS News Hour segment on the new version of Mark Twain’s autobiography. Twain specified that his entire autobiography could not be published until 100 years after his death. In so far as he died in 1910, this is the year that it will be released. This is a book that I’m very much [...]

Invasive Species Awareness Week Begins July 12th
July 11th, 2010 · Comments Off
Lake George’s Invasive Species Awareness Week (ISAW) begins next week, and coincides with the release of a new report by the New York State Invasive Species Council. Entitled: A Regulatory System for Non-Native Species, the report has been sent to Governor Patterson and the legislature for review. Those interested in learning more about invasive species [...]
